Index of /ttepla.com/upload/uf/417/gqougzs8ymr1c9eqknv0hzkyjb0d9pk3
Name
Last modified
Size
Description
Parent Directory
-
IMG_20230209_121057.jpg
2024-08-06 01:25
148K